What's Philmont??
Philmont Scout Ranch is a national camping area, owned and operated by the Boy Scouts of America. Philmont is quite large, comprising 137,493 acres or about 215 square miles of rugged mountain wilderness in the Sangre de Cristo (Blood of Christ) range of the Rockies. 32 staffed camps and 50 unstaffed camps are operated by the ranch. Philmont has high mountains which dominate rough terrain with an elevation ranging from 6,500 to 12,441 feet. Scouts from all over the country come to spend time in this beautiful place on eleven-day "treks," carrying all their equipment in backpacks.
